/*
|
|
* Description:
|
|
* Check various errnos for preadv2(2).
|
|
* 1) preadv2() fails and sets errno to EINVAL if iov_len is invalid.
|
|
* 2) preadv2() fails and sets errno to EINVAL if the vector count iovcnt
|
|
* is less than zero.
|
|
* 3) preadv2() fails and sets errno to EOPNOTSUPP if flag is invalid.
|
|
* 4) preadv2() fails and sets errno to EFAULT when attempts to read into
|
|
* a invalid address.
|
|
* 5) preadv2() fails and sets errno to EBADF if file descriptor is invalid.
|
|
* 6) preadv2() fails and sets errno to EBADF if file descriptor is not
|
|
* open for reading.
|
|
* 7) preadv2() fails and sets errno to EISDIR when fd refers to a directory.
|
|
* 8) preadv2() fails and sets errno to ESPIPE if fd is associated with a pipe.
|
|
*/
